The Cube Street Mini is designed as a compact PA solution for musicians who need amplification without complex setup or external gear. Its dual-channel layout allows simultaneous use of an instrument and a microphone, making it suitable for solo performers or duos. The main channel supports guitars, keyboards or stereo instruments, while the dedicated mic channel uses an XLR/TRS combo input for dynamic microphones. This flexible input configuration makes the Cube Street Mini practical for a wide range of acoustic and low-volume performance situations.
A built-in 2.1 speaker system combines a central five-inch speaker with dual tweeters to deliver balanced sound with wide dispersion. This design helps vocals and instruments project evenly throughout a room, reducing the need for precise speaker positioning. An integrated tilt stand and mic stand mount further improve sound projection, allowing the amplifier to be angled or elevated for better coverage in small venues, rehearsal rooms and indoor performance spaces.
Each channel includes dedicated effects designed to enhance live performance without external pedals or processors. The main channel offers reverb, delay and chorus, while the microphone channel provides reverb and echo for vocal clarity. An onboard guitar tuner with panel indicators allows quick tuning checks between songs, and a stereo mini output enables silent practice or connection to a recorder. These tools support practical performance needs while keeping operation straightforward.
A built-in rechargeable battery provides up to seven hours of playing time, allowing performances without access to mains power. Charging is handled via USB-C, with a cable included for convenience. Bluetooth audio support enables wireless playback of backing tracks from a phone or tablet, making rehearsals and performances more flexible. Compact dimensions, an integrated carry handle and an optional carrying case make the Cube Street Mini easy to transport between sessions.
